The Great Bell Chant: End of Suffering
Following my post wherein I feature a video disputing the omnibenevolence of the Christian deity (Yahweh) I have been asked what it is that I do believe.
At the crux of my belief system is the belief that all things are composed of energy. Energy cannot be destroyed, it can only change form. Thus, when asked if I believe in an afterlife, my answer is yes. The energy which powered the body does not cease to exist when the body dies. It takes on a new form. It is my belief that this energy generally finds a new body to inhabit. There is no set period of time in which it "must" do this.
Can we change the world on a spiritual level as well as a physical one?
I believe that chants, prayer, and spells are all forms of tapping into energy, of altering energy currents, of increasing energy. The form is not so important as the intent. One belief system's form of tapping into the energy is not superior to another belief system's way of doing so.
I have been accused of ridiculing Christianity. I repeat that I do not ridicule Christianity as a whole. I'm completely in favor of religious tolerance, and that includes not ridiculing other people's belief systems, whether or not I am inclined to belief the particulars of said system. But I do ridicule dogma and sanctimoniousness.
Let us raise the energy in favor of love, tolerance, and peace.

The Lost Books of the Bible: My Story
Hello friends. As a young girl, I was raised Catholic, and I was actually quite devout, although I was rather unconventional in my beliefs. This led me to be ostracized by some of the members of the church. In turn, this led me to question the organization to which I had so long been faithful, although not without question.
I eventually left the church and started studying the older religions. At this point I would call myself a Pagan, although I do take wisdom from other sources as well. I still study other tomes, including the Bible. However, the King James bible has had many chapters removed from it. This book that so many take literally has been abriged, primarily for political reasons.
I have a bible which contains the Lost Books. It makes for very fascinating reading. It is one of my favorite books.
I wish to share the videos from the History Channel, which talk of the Lost Books of the Bible. I hope you will enjoy them too.
